Proceeding contribution from Shabana Mahmood (Labour) in the House of Commons on Monday, 19 July 2010. It occurred during Debate on bill on Academies Bill [Lords].
Academies Bill [Lords]
Tony Blair is no longer the leader of my party, and I was elected in May 2010. Although I agree with much of what he did when he was Prime Minister and leader of our great party, I do not agree with all of what he said and did. That was not the point that I was making, however, which was about the Bill and the fact that it focuses on pre-approving outstanding schools. That gives away what it is all about—creating a two-tier system.
